.TH "aflibAudioStereoToMono" 3 "8 May 2002" "Open Source Audio Library Project" \" -*- nroff -*-.ad l.nh.SH NAMEaflibAudioStereoToMono \- Implements mixing a stereo or mono signal to a mono signal. .SH SYNOPSIS.br.PP\fC#include <aflibAudioStereoToMono.h>\fP.PPInherits \fBaflibAudioMixer\fP..PP.SS "Public Types".in +1c.ti -1c.RI "enum \fBaflib_mix_type\fP { \fBAFLIB_MIX_UNDEF\fP, \fBAFLIB_MIX_BOTH\fP, \fBAFLIB_MIX_CHAN1\fP, \fBAFLIB_MIX_CHAN2\fP }".br.in -1c.SS "Public Methods".in +1c.ti -1c.RI "\fBaflibAudioStereoToMono\fP (\fBaflibAudio\fP &audio, \fBaflibAudioStereoToMono::aflib_mix_type\fP mix=AFLIB_MIX_BOTH, int amplitude=100)".br.RI "\fIConstructor for type of mixing operation.\fP".ti -1c.RI "\fB~aflibAudioStereoToMono\fP ()".br.RI "\fIDestructor.\fP".ti -1c.RI "void \fBsetMixType\fP (\fBaflibAudioStereoToMono::aflib_mix_type\fP mix)".br.RI "\fISets the type of mixing to perform.\fP".ti -1c.RI "void \fBsetAmplitude\fP (int amplitude)".br.RI "\fISets the amplitude.\fP".ti -1c.RI "const char * \fBgetName\fP () const".br.RI "\fIReturns the name of the derived class.\fP".in -1c.SH "DETAILED DESCRIPTION".PP Implements mixing a stereo or mono signal to a mono signal..PPThis class implements converting a stereo or mono signal into a mono signal. It will output either a mix of both channels 1 and 2 inputs, channel 1, or channel 2..PPThis class is a convience class derived from \fBaflibAudioMixer\fP since this is a commonly used operation. It takes either a mono or stereo signal so that the programmer does not need to worry about the source. .PP.SH "MEMBER ENUMERATION DOCUMENTATION".PP .SS "enum aflibAudioStereoToMono::aflib_mix_type".PP\fBEnumeration values:\fP.in +1c.TP\fB\fI\fIAFLIB_MIX_UNDEF\fP \fP\fP.TP\fB\fI\fIAFLIB_MIX_BOTH\fP \fP\fP.TP\fB\fI\fIAFLIB_MIX_CHAN1\fP \fP\fP.TP\fB\fI\fIAFLIB_MIX_CHAN2\fP \fP\fP.SH "CONSTRUCTOR & DESTRUCTOR DOCUMENTATION".PP .SS "aflibAudioStereoToMono::aflibAudioStereoToMono (\fBaflibAudio\fP & audio, \fBaflibAudioStereoToMono::aflib_mix_type\fP mix = AFLIB_MIX_BOTH, int amplitude = 100)".PPConstructor for type of mixing operation..PPThis constructor allows one to mix any input to a mono signal. It will mix both channels (\fBaflibAudioStereoToMono::AFLIB_MIX_BOTH\fP), or channel 1 (\fBaflibAudioStereoToMono::AFLIB_MIX_CHAN1\fP), or channel 2 (\fBaflibAudioStereoToMono::AFLIB_MIX_CHAN2\fP). .SS "aflibAudioStereoToMono::~aflibAudioStereoToMono ()".PPDestructor..PP.SH "MEMBER FUNCTION DOCUMENTATION".PP .SS "const char* aflibAudioStereoToMono::getName () const\fC [inline, virtual]\fP".PPReturns the name of the derived class..PPReimplemented from \fBaflibAudioMixer\fP..SS "void aflibAudioStereoToMono::setAmplitude (int amplitude)".PPSets the amplitude..PPThis function allows one to change the amplitude. values between 1 and 100 are supported. .SS "void aflibAudioStereoToMono::setMixType (\fBaflibAudioStereoToMono::aflib_mix_type\fP mix)".PPSets the type of mixing to perform..PPThis function allows one to change the type of mixing performed..PPOne can select both channels (\fBaflibAudioStereoToMono::AFLIB_MIX_BOTH\fP), or channel 1 (\fBaflibAudioStereoToMono::AFLIB_MIX_CHAN1\fP), or channel 2 (\fBaflibAudioStereoToMono::AFLIB_MIX_CHAN2\fP). .SH "AUTHOR".PP Generated automatically by Doxygen for Open Source Audio Library Project from the source code.
